2. Request honest reviews without turning client experience into a sales script

Bosseo’s public Reputation & Reviews page describes automated review requests to real clients, including requests connected to stated matter milestones, and says the service does not buy, fake or incentivize reviews. For a law firm, the important implementation question is not only when a request is sent. It is whether the firm can identify eligible clients, avoid exposing confidential information and ask consistently across appropriate matters. A positive client experience should remain the client’s own account, not a promised outcome or a request for particular wording.

Recommended approach

Create written eligibility rules before activating requests. Include the matter events that may trigger an invitation, the matters that require exclusion or extra care, the information staff may use, and the person responsible for resolving exceptions. Have counsel review the policy for applicable professional-conduct and platform requirements.

3. Treat responses as public communications

The Bosseo page describes professional responses to positive and negative reviews, with responses generated in the firm’s voice and an option for sensitive reviews to receive approval before posting. A public reply to a legal-services review must not disclose confidential facts, confirm a representation relationship, argue the merits of a matter or promise a result. The response should address the public comment without creating a second client file in the review section.

Recommended approach

Set response rules by risk level. Routine feedback may use an approved tone and limited language. Reviews that mention a case, outcome, dispute, health information or alleged misconduct should be routed for human review. Measure response coverage and review the wording periodically; do not treat automatic posting as a substitute for professional judgment.

6. Plan for negative, disputed and policy-violating reviews

Bosseo describes a negative-review protocol that includes a professional public response, an effort to move the conversation offline and a removal request for reviews that violate Google policies. That is different from removing an unfavorable review merely because it is unfavorable. A response can show attentiveness, but it cannot replace a factual internal review of the underlying concern or a careful assessment of confidentiality and professional obligations.

Recommended approach

Adopt an escalation path before launch. Identify who reviews a complaint, who approves a public response, when the firm may request removal, and when the matter must be handled privately. Keep the public response narrow and respectful. Record the decision internally without publishing client details or suggesting that a review is invalid simply because it is negative.

Can a review request mention a case result?+

Do not assume that it can. Review-request language and public responses should be reviewed for confidentiality, professional-conduct requirements and platform rules. The safest policy is to avoid asking for confidential facts, promised outcomes or specific wording.

Will more reviews guarantee better Google rankings or more calls?+

No guarantee should be assumed. Bosseo’s page discusses review activity in relation to local visibility, while Google states that autom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ing or search visibility. Measure activity and qualified inquiries separately.

How should we handle a negative review?+

Create an approval path for a narrow, professional public response, avoid confirming confidential information, and consider a removal request only when the review appears to violate an applicable platform policy. A negative opinion is not automatically a policy violation.
